An inverter is one of the most important pieces of equipment in a solar energy system. It’s a device that converts direct current (DC) electricity, which is what a solar panel generates, to alternating current (AC) electricity, which the electrical grid uses. In DC, electricity is maintained at.

Mostly found in solar power generation systems, photovoltaic inverters are devices that transform DC power into AC power. For usage in energy storage systems, energy storage inverters convert DC power kept in batteries into AC electricity. The two differ mostly in that the input end power sources.

PV inverters are designed as one-way power converters, channeling solar energy directly to your home or the grid. Energy storage inverters operate as intelligent energy managers, featuring bidirectional power flow capabilities that coordinate with battery systems. This allows them to store excess.

A PV inverter converts DC power from solar panels into AC power for residential and industrial electricity needs. It usually includes a transformer, a set of electronic components and integrated circuits, which can convert the direct current (DC) emitted by photovoltaic panels into the alternating.

An energy storage inverter is a device that converts direct current (DC) electricity into alternating current (AC) electricity within an energy storage system. It manages the charging and discharging process of battery systems, regulates grid frequency, balances power, and serves as a core.

What is solar inverter based generation?

As more solar systems are added to the grid, more inverters are being connected to the grid than ever before. Inverter-based generation can produce energy at any frequency and does not have the same inertial properties as steam-based generation, because there is no turbine involved.
